[Closed] "Gohei Mochi Mihara," the filming location for NHK's "Hanbun, Aoi.", has closed.

The gohei mochi shop "" in Iwamuracho, Ena City, Gifu Prefecture, is famous as the location for the NHK drama series "Hanbun, Aoi.", which aired from April to September 2018.Mihara" closed on Sunday, May 12th. Thank you for your hard work over the past 44 years.
